RTO Management Beginnings

Leading a Registered Training Organisation (RTO) in Australia is a gratifying yet complex endeavor.

The regulatory framework, overseen by the Australian Skills Quality Authority (ASQA), is complex and continuously changing.

Although the possibility of non-compliance can be intimidating, working with the right RTO consultant can turn this challenge into a chance for growth and improvement.

However, consultants vary significantly in quality.

Picking a partner who has the right experience, professionalism, and commitment to your success is vital for handling the complexities of RTO compliance.

The Advantages of a Qualified RTO Consultant for Australian RTOs

The VET sector in Australia is constantly evolving, with standards and regulations regularly updated to meet industry needs and best practices.

An experienced and well-versed RTO consultant ensures your organisation stays ahead and complies with the latest requirements.

Their expertise spans a wide range of critical areas:

Designing and Reviewing Curriculum

- An experienced RTO consultant will work with you to create or enhance your training and assessment materials, making sure they meet industry standards, engage learners, and comply with ASQA's stringent requirements.

Internal Audit Coordination

- Routine internal audits are essential for identifying and addressing compliance issues before they grow.

- An experienced consultant will lead you through the audit process and offer key insights and actionable advice for improvement.

ASQA Audit Improvements

- Undergoing an ASQA audit can be challenging, but the right RTO consultant ensures you can face it with assurance.

- They help prepare all essential documents, handle areas of concern, and make sure your RTO is presented well.

Implementing Continuous Betterment

- Ensuring compliance is a continuous activity, not a single occurrence.

- An experienced RTO consultant will assess your RTO's performance data and work alongside you to apply continuous improvement strategies that refine your training and assessment approaches.

Handling Risks

- Each RTO encounters risks from both within the organisation and outside.

- A knowledgeable consultant can assist you in identifying potential risks to your compliance and reputation, and create proactive strategies to address them.

New RTO Registration and Application

- RTO consultants offer support for the entire registration process of a new RTO, ensuring all necessary evidence and documentation are collected and submitted to ASQA.

Perils of Hiring the Wrong RTO Consultant

Hiring the right RTO consultant can be advantageous, but choosing the wrong one can be detrimental to your organisation.

An inexperienced or unprofessional consultant might overlook key non-compliances, offer incorrect advice, or not meet their commitments.

- This may result in:

Higher Risk of Non-Compliance

- Overlooking even minor non-compliances can become major issues during an ASQA audit, resulting in sanctions, funding cuts, or even registration cancellation.

Monetary Losses

- Rectifying non-compliances can be costly, and the financial consequences of a failed audit can be ruinous for an RTO.

Reputation Detriment

- A damaged reputation can make it difficult to attract and retain students, staff, and industry partners.

Time and Resource Loss

- Engaging a subpar consultant can result in wasted time and resources, as you may need to re-do work or seek additional support from other experts.
